Cyclist seriously injured in Kitchener collision, charges pending

A 23-year-old man from Kitchener was airlifted to an out-of-region hospital following a serious crash on Friday morning.
It was just after midnight when emergency crews were called out to the area of Courtland Avenue East and Cedar Street South for a collision between a Ford motor vehicle and that cyclist.
The 23-year-old is said to have sustained serious injuries.
The driver of the involved Ford was not injured.
Police say the intersection where the collision occurred was closed for several hours for an investigation, though it has since reopened.
Charges are expected to be laid as a result of the crash.
Anyone that may have witnessed the incident is asked to contact police or Crime Stoppers.
